The definition is at the end of the clue.
How the clue works
Right, so novice at the end is your definition, a beginner. For the wordplay, "pay attention" gives you NB (that's from nota bene, the old "note well" abbreviation), and that gets wrapped "about" EW — East and West being your opposing compass points — giving NEWB. Then just stick IE on the end, since "namely" is the classic clue-writer's shorthand for that abbreviation, and you've built NEWBIE.
